Why four families
A list of twenty permit types does not tell you what to do. A signal is only worth the sentence it lets you write, so we grouped them by that sentence. In the app, every signal links out to the original public document — you can always go check before you call.
The money is confirmed
The budget exists and it was just unlocked
A business that just won a public contract or registered a housing project has a dated budget, a deadline, and an obligation to deliver. This is by far the densest family in the feed.

What it gives you — A reason to call that is not a cold pitch: “congratulations on the City of… contract.” You have the date, the amount where it is public, and the buyer.
They are buying right now
The order is open, or about to be
A published tender, a construction permit issued, an environmental authorization granted, a land-use change filed: each one opens a buying sequence — materials, subcontractors, professional services, equipment.

What it gives you — You arrive during the window instead of three months later, once the supplier has already been chosen.
They just opened
Everything is still up for decision
A brand-new alcohol permit, a brand-new construction licence, an establishment opening, a builder accreditation: the business does not yet have a regular supplier for half of what it needs.

What it gives you — The one window where “we already have someone” is not the default answer.
Their situation just changed
Good or bad, news that changes your message
Hiring resuming after a quiet stretch, an expansion, an acquisition — or a violation to fix and a collective layoff. They sit in the same family because they do the same thing: they make the message you had prepared wrong.

What it gives you — You do not write the same thing to a business that is hiring and one that is laying off. This family also tells you when not to call at all.
What this page does not tell you
The engine watches 20 event types. This page presents 18: the ones that have actually produced a result in the feed since we started tracking them. The other two are under active watch — their sources run every day — but no match has been recorded yet, and a detection you cannot verify is not a feature. They will appear here the day they fire, not before.
